Closes #1551.

Motivation

#1551 flagged three concerns with samples/: credentials always on the
command line, several samples using .get() where they meant to page,
and no examples for background jobs or subscriptions. Each of the three
gets one commit for reviewability.

Behavior change

Samples only -- no library changes. Users running the sample scripts
directly will see:

Credentials. samples/_shared.py adds resolve_credentials(args)
which fills missing sign-in values from env vars
(TABLEAU_SERVER, TABLEAU_TOKEN_NAME, etc.), a plain .env file, or
getpass.getpass(), in that precedence order. CLI args continue to
work for CI use. Wired into login.py, publish_workbook.py, and
publish_datasource.py to establish the pattern; other samples left
alone to keep the diff surgical. Stdlib only, no new deps.

Short flags on the shared helper match tabcmd's canonical set: -s
--server, -t --site, -u --username, -p --password, -l
--logging-level. --token-name and --token-value are long-only.
An earlier iteration of this PR reassigned -p to --token-name; that
was corrected before merge -- see 54e51f5.

Pagination fixes. Several samples called
server.<endpoint>.get() and named the result all_workbooks, which
only returns the first page (default 100). Replaces those with
TSC.Pager(...) so every page is walked. Where a total count was
displayed we still .get() once to grab total_available; that means
one extra request but preserves the count line.

Also fixes an unrelated bug in getting_started/3_hello_universe.py
where the "workbooks" section actually queried datasources.

New samples.

  • list_jobs.py -- background jobs (extract refreshes, publishes,
    flow runs) with .filter() queryset API + wait_for_job
  • manage_subscriptions.py -- list/create/delete subscriptions with
    SubscriptionItem/Target and paginated listing

Not exhaustive on coverage -- data alerts, metrics, tables, databases,
virtual connections still have no dedicated sample. Left for follow-up.

Test plan

samples/ has no automated tests; each check below is manual.

  • python samples/login.py --help shows the new flags with updated help text
  • Setting TABLEAU_TOKEN_NAME / TABLEAU_TOKEN_VALUE in env and running
    python samples/login.py -s <server> signs in with no secrets on the CLI
  • python samples/list_jobs.py --hours 24 lists recent jobs;
    --wait <job_id> blocks until completion
  • python samples/manage_subscriptions.py list prints existing subs;
    create + delete round-trips cleanly
  • Rewritten pagination in explore_datasource.py, explore_workbook.py,
    extracts.py, update_workbook_data_freshness_policy.py, and
    publish_workbook.py returns correct behavior on a >100-item site

Introduces samples/_shared.py with resolve_credentials(args), which fills
missing sign-in values from env vars (TABLEAU_SERVER, TABLEAU_TOKEN_NAME,
etc.) or a .env-style file, and falls back to interactive getpass so
secrets never touch shell history. CLI args still work for CI use.

Wires the new helper into login.py, publish_workbook.py, and
publish_datasource.py to establish the pattern; the remaining samples
still accept the same CLI args and continue to work as before.

Addresses #1551 item 1.
Several samples called `server.<endpoint>.get()` and named the result
`all_workbooks`, `all_datasources`, etc. This only returns the first page
(default 100 items); if the item of interest was not on that page it was
silently missed and the sample failed with a "not found" message.

Replace those calls with `TSC.Pager(server.<endpoint>)` so every page is
walked. Where a total count was being displayed we still make one plain
`.get()` up front so the total_available field is available without
paging through the whole site twice.

Also corrects an unrelated typo in getting_started/3_hello_universe.py
where the "workbooks" section actually queried datasources.

Addresses #1551 item 2 (and #1531).
The existing samples cover workbooks, datasources, schedules, extracts,
projects, users, groups, favorites, and webhooks, but there was no
sample for two frequently asked-about endpoints:

  * list_jobs.py -- lists background jobs (extract refreshes, publishes,
    flow runs, etc.), demonstrating the .filter() queryset with
    date/status/type filters and the wait_for_job helper.
  * manage_subscriptions.py -- list/create/delete site subscriptions,
    demonstrating the SubscriptionItem + Target pattern and paginated
    listing with TSC.Pager.

Both samples use the new samples/_shared.py credential resolver so the
sign-in pattern matches the rest of the samples.

Addresses #1551 item 3.

Restore -t for --site, -u for --username, -p for --password; drop short
flags on --token-name and --token-value. This matches tabcmd's canonical
short flags in tabcmd/execution/parent_parser.py so users running both
tools have one convention to remember.

The initial refactor picked new short flags without noticing that the
old samples/login.py already followed tabcmd's convention (-p was
--password, -t was --site). Reassigning -p to --token-name meant
`python login.py -p <password>` silently sent the password as a token
name.
